Martin Monk is a scholar working on Education, Developmental and Educational Psychology and Cognitive Neuroscience.
According to data from OpenAlex, Martin Monk has authored 40 papers receiving a total of 1.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 32 papers in Education, 15 papers in Developmental and Educational Psychology and 3 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ience. Recurrent topics in Martin Monk’s work include Science Education and Pedagogy (16 papers), Educational Strategies and Epistemologies (11 papers) and Teacher Education and Leadership Studies (10 papers). Martin Monk is often cited by papers focused on Science Education and Pedagogy (16 papers), Educational Strategies and Epistemologies (11 papers) and Teacher Education and Leadership Studies (10 papers). Martin Monk coll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, Zimbabwe and South Africa. Martin Monk's co-authors include Jonathan Osborne, Shirley Simon, Sibel Erduran, Sally Johnson, Richard A. Duschl, Nicholas Smith, Rod Watson, Brian Wilson, Justin Dillon and Sally Johnson and has published in prestigious journals such as Epidemiologic Reviews, Science Education and International Journal of Science Education.
